Skip to main content

A Data–Driven Approximation of the Koopman Operator: Extending Dynamic Mode Decomposition

Author(s): Williams, Matthew O; Kevrekidis, Ioannis G; Rowley, Clarence W

Download
To refer to this page use: http://arks.princeton.edu/ark:/88435/pr1x609
Full metadata record
DC FieldValueLanguage
dc.contributor.authorWilliams, Matthew O-
dc.contributor.authorKevrekidis, Ioannis G-
dc.contributor.authorRowley, Clarence W-
dc.date.accessioned2016-10-17T14:14:47Z-
dc.date.available2016-10-17T14:14:47Z-
dc.date.issued2015-12en_US
dc.identifier.citationWilliams, Matthew O, Kevrekidis, Ioannis G, Rowley, Clarence W. "A Data–Driven Approximation of the Koopman Operator: Extending Dynamic Mode Decomposition" Journal of Nonlinear Science, 25, 6,1307 - 1346, doi:10.1007/s00332-015-9258-5en_US
dc.identifier.issn0938-8974-
dc.identifier.urihttp://arks.princeton.edu/ark:/88435/pr1x609-
dc.description.abstractThe Koopman operator is a linear but infinite-dimensional operator that governs the evolution of scalar observables defined on the state space of an autonomous dynamical system and is a powerful tool for the analysis and decomposition of nonlinear dynamical systems. In this manuscript, we present a data-driven method for approximating the leading eigenvalues, eigenfunctions, and modes of the Koopman operator. The method requires a data set of snapshot pairs and a dictionary of scalar observables, but does not require explicit governing equations or interaction with a “black box” integrator. We will show that this approach is, in effect, an extension of dynamic mode decomposition (DMD), which has been used to approximate the Koopman eigenvalues and modes. Furthermore, if the data provided to the method are generated by a Markov process instead of a deterministic dynamical system, the algorithm approximates the eigenfunctions of the Kolmogorov backward equation, which could be considered as the “stochastic Koopman operator” (Mezic in Nonlinear Dynamics 41(1–3): 309–325, 2005). Finally, four illustrative examples are presented: two that highlight the quantitative performance of the method when presented with either deterministic or stochastic data and two that show potential applications of the Koopman eigenfunctions.en_US
dc.format.extent1307 - 1346en_US
dc.relation.ispartofJournal of Nonlinear Scienceen_US
dc.rightsThis is the author’s final manuscript. All rights reserved to author(s).en_US
dc.titleA Data–Driven Approximation of the Koopman Operator: Extending Dynamic Mode Decompositionen_US
dc.typeJournal Articleen_US
dc.identifier.doidoi:10.1007/s00332-015-9258-5-
dc.date.eissued2015-06-05en_US
dc.identifier.eissn1432-1467-

Files in This Item:
File Description SizeFormat 
RowleyJoNSV25-2015.pdf2.71 MBAdobe PDFView/Download


Items in OAR@Princeton are protected by copyright, with all rights reserved, unless otherwise indicated.